Holy baptism is the foundation of the whole life of Christians, the entrance to the soul's life (CV), and the door to the other sacrament. "Baptism, we are liberated from sin and reborn as a child of God, we become members of Christ, become incorporated into the church and become co-owners of their mission" Baptism is by water and its resurrection "(CCC) 1213)

People become children of the church through holy baptism. Baptism is the door to Christianity, the beginning of the life of God. Baptism restores the appearance of God in humans and gives Christ the power of salvation for the redemption feat. Through baptism, Christians can get all sacrament and actions of grace of the church, whereby he can be deified. Baptism is called the second birth. Because, among them, one dies from his sinful life, and he is reborn into a truly righteous and sacred new, spiritual, sacred life.
